How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Manchester?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Manchester Studio Apartments | $1,763 | $950 | $2,549 |
| Manchester 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,788 | $1,200 | $2,551 |
| Manchester 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,256 | $1,350 | $3,120 |
| Manchester 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,250 | $1,900 | $2,676 |
| Manchester 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,299 | $2,299 | $2,299 |
